1. Look online for job postings and classified ads.
2. Speak to friends, family, or colleagues who may know of possible technician jobs in Salem.
3. Attend career fairs and networking events specific to technicians in the area you are interested in working in (e.g., medical equipment manufacturers).
4. Go through training programs offered by local colleges or technical schools that focus on technician occupations (many offer evening/weekend classes so that workers can continue their employment while taking courses).
5: Ask employers directly if they have any openings; many will be happy to share information about upcoming positions or contact someone within the company who would know more about available opportunities
